So anyway, here is what the colors on the map mean, that should help you:
Light green: plains
Green: forest
Dark Green: jungle
White: arctic/tundra
Yellow: desert
Speckled Yellow: Swamp
Speckled Gray: Wastelands
Black: Mountains
Dark Blue: Rivers
Light Blue: Ocean
If you look at the map REALLY close, you'll see some occasional black dots. There are two in M'Chek. The southern one on the waterfront is Mikona. The one in the north is Blandenberg.
There is one in the middle of T'Nanshi, underneath the lettering if you strain to see it. That's Le'Or T'Nanshi.
On the west coast you'll see a spot that says The Seven Cities. Those dots in there are the Seven Cities. There is an eighth dot just over the border to the north in Brekon. That is the City of Brekon.
In the Kurathene Empire, near the middle there is another dot. That's the city of Kuras, the capitol.
In Jechran there is a spot where a river forks, towards the east. At that fork is the city of Myleah. There is no dot there yet.
In Drotid along the coast, about two-thirds up the coastline where the land comes in a little bit are two citys. The southernmost one is Grantir. Then slightly to the north, no more than 50 miles up is the ruins of Toostan.
In Ferrell, about where the dot that marks the country is, there is the city of Kitanya.
That's pretty much all of them at the moment. We've got a campaign going on in Drotid right now, run by my co-creator, ceardan. He may be doing a few more cities in there, so I'll have to get them from him later.
